Output 840ffaff44726703c528d26880c3769be674d5ca004f4a27ff0a89a58832cdba:1

value
1004069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d59716c3905f8ab8ac1453791ab737892eb5a44a OP_EQUAL
address
3MANrFDcA7CyVBWiQc2DyyhNXxDGeSPbC3
transaction
840ffaff44726703c528d26880c3769be674d5ca004f4a27ff0a89a58832cdba
spent
true